The History of Casinos:

The origins of casinos can be traced back to ancient civilizations, where people engaged in various forms of gambling as a form of entertainment. However, the concept of a modern casino, with a dedicated space for gambling activities, emerged in 17th-century Italy. The word “casino” itself is derived from the Italian word “casa,” meaning house, and initially referred to a small villa or summerhouse.

The first true casino, as we know it today, was established in Venice in 1638. Over the centuries, casinos spread across Europe and later made their way to the United States. The famous gambling haven of Las Vegas, with its dazzling lights and iconic Strip, became synonymous with the casino experience in the mid-20th century.

Types of Casino Games:

Casinos offer a diverse array of games, catering to a wide range of preferences and skill levels. Here are some of the most popular casino games:

  1. Slot Machines: These colorful, flashing machines are a staple in any casino. With themes ranging from classic fruit symbols to elaborate storylines, slot machines appeal to players seeking a mix of luck and entertainment.
  2. Table Games: Classics like blackjack, poker, roulette, and baccarat are mainstays in casinos. These games require a combination of skill, strategy, and luck, making them popular choices for those looking for a more interactive experience.
  3. Poker Rooms: Many casinos have dedicated poker rooms where players can engage in various poker variants, from Texas Hold’em to Omaha. Poker tournaments often attract skilled players and enthusiasts alike.
  4. Sports Betting: Some casinos have sportsbooks, allowing patrons to place bets on various sporting events. This adds an extra layer of excitement, especially for those who follow sports closely.

Beyond Gambling: Entertainment and Hospitality:

Modern casinos are not merely gambling venues; they have evolved into entertainment complexes offering a wide range of amenities. Many feature world-class restaurants, live entertainment shows, nightclubs, and even shopping centers. The goal is to provide a complete experience that extends beyond the casino floor, making them attractive destinations for tourists and locals alike.

Cultural Impact:

Casinos have had a significant impact on popular culture, influencing movies, literature, and music. Countless films, from classics like “Casablanca” to modern blockbusters like “Ocean’s Eleven,” have depicted the allure and intrigue of casinos. The atmosphere of risk and reward, along with the glamorous settings, continues to captivate audiences worldwide.
